阿里云服务器数据库如何设置自动扩展和收缩?

在当今的云计算环境中,数据库的自动扩展(Scale-Out)和收缩(Scale-In)是确保应用程序性能和成本效益的关键。阿里云提供了强大的工具和服务,帮助用户轻松实现数据库的自动扩展和收缩。本文将详细介绍如何在阿里云服务器上设置数据库的自动扩展和收缩功能。

阿里云服务器数据库如何设置自动扩展和收缩?

一、了解自动扩展和收缩的概念

自动扩展是指当数据库负载增加时,系统能够自动添加更多的资源(如计算能力、存储空间等),以应对更高的工作负载。而自动收缩则是在负载减少时,系统能够自动释放多余的资源,避免浪费。

这种机制不仅有助于提高系统的响应速度和稳定性,还能显著降低运营成本,尤其是在流量波动较大的应用场景中。

二、阿里云数据库服务概述

阿里云提供了多种数据库服务,包括关系型数据库(RDS)、分布式数据库(PolarDB)、以及NoSQL数据库(如Redis、MongoDB等)。不同的数据库类型有不同的扩展和收缩策略,但总体思路相似。

为了实现自动扩展和收缩,阿里云提供了弹性伸缩(Auto Scaling)功能,用户可以根据预设的条件(如CPU利用率、内存使用率、IOPS等)自动调整数据库实例的配置。

三、设置自动扩展和收缩的步骤

1. 登录阿里云控制台

登录到阿里云官网,进入控制台。选择你需要管理的数据库服务(例如RDS或PolarDB),然后点击进入对应的管理页面。

2. 配置监控指标

在数据库管理页面中,找到“监控与告警”选项。这里可以设置监控指标,如CPU使用率、内存使用率、磁盘I/O、连接数等。这些指标将作为触发自动扩展和收缩的依据。

3. 创建弹性伸缩规则

接下来,创建弹性伸缩规则。你可以根据业务需求设定具体的阈值。例如,当CPU使用率超过80%时,自动增加实例规格;当CPU使用率低于30%时,自动降低实例规格。规则可以针对不同时间段进行定制,以适应业务高峰期和低谷期的变化。

4. 设置通知与日志

为了更好地掌握数据库的扩展和收缩情况,建议开启通知功能。可以通过短信、邮件等方式接收告警信息,并定期查看操作日志,确保所有变更都在可控范围内。

四、注意事项

1. 评估业务需求

在配置自动扩展和收缩之前,务必充分评估业务的实际需求。过度频繁的扩展和收缩可能会导致性能抖动,影响用户体验。合理设置阈值非常重要。

2. 测试与优化

初次配置后,建议进行一段时间的压力测试,观察实际效果。根据测试结果,不断优化弹性伸缩规则,找到最适合你业务的最佳实践。

3. 成本控制

虽然自动扩展可以帮助提升性能,但也可能带来额外的成本。在配置过程中,始终关注费用变化,确保在性能和成本之间取得平衡。

五、总结

通过阿里云提供的弹性伸缩功能,用户可以轻松实现数据库的自动扩展和收缩,从而更好地应对业务负载的变化。合理的配置不仅可以提高系统的稳定性和响应速度,还能有效降低成本,实现资源的最大化利用。

希望本文能帮助你在阿里云平台上顺利配置数据库的自动扩展和收缩功能,为你的业务发展保驾护航。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/207202.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月24日 上午6:14
下一篇 2025年1月24日 上午6:14

相关推荐

  • 修改Bluehost数据库密码后网站无法访问怎么办?

    在使用 Bluehost 托管服务时,您可能会遇到需要更改数据库密码的情况。虽然这是一个常规操作,但有时修改密码后会导致网站无法正常访问。如果您遇到了这种情况,请不要担心,本文将为您提供详细的解决步骤。 检查错误信息 当您尝试访问您的网站并收到错误提示时,仔细阅读这些信息非常重要。常见的错误可能包括“500 内部服务器错误”或“数据库连接失败”。这些提示可以…

    2025年1月20日
    700
  • 免费云MySQL数据库的连接限制和解决方案是什么?

    在使用免费云MySQL数据库时,通常会遇到一些连接上的限制。这些限制是服务提供商为了确保其平台稳定运行而设置的。对于大多数用户来说,了解并适应这些限制是非常重要的。 常见的连接限制包括但不限于:最大并发连接数、每小时或每天的最大查询次数等。不同的云服务商可能会有不同的规定,因此在选择之前应该仔细阅读相关文档。 解决方案 针对上述提到的各种连接限制,我们可以采…

    2025年1月20日
    700
  • ECSHOP数据库连接失败?教你快速排查与解决方法

    对于使用ECShop的电商网站来说,数据库连接是整个系统正常运行的基础。当出现数据库连接失败的问题时,会严重影响网站的正常使用。那么,当ECShop数据库连接失败时,我们该如何快速排查并解决问题呢?本文将为您提供一份详细的解决方案。 一、检查配置文件 1. 检查数据库配置信息: 首先要确保配置文件中的数据库信息是否正确,例如数据库地址、端口、用户名、密码等。…

    2025年1月19日
    1000
  • 如何在腾讯云服务器上实现多地区数据库同步?

    随着业务的发展,企业对于数据存储和处理的需求也在不断增长。为了满足用户在不同地区的访问需求,提高系统的可用性和容错能力,越来越多的企业选择将数据库部署到多个地理区域,并实现跨区域的数据同步。本文将介绍如何在腾讯云服务器上实现多地区数据库同步。 1. 选择合适的数据库类型 在腾讯云上可以选择关系型数据库(如MySQL、PostgreSQL)或NoSQL数据库(…

    2025年1月22日
    900
  • MSSQL支持哪些高可用性和灾难恢复解决方案?

    在当今数字化时代,企业对数据的安全性和可用性要求越来越高。为了应对这些问题,微软SQL Server(MSSQL)提供了多种高可用性和灾难恢复解决方案,以确保数据库服务的持续运行和数据的完整性。 一、Always On可用性组 1. 工作原理: Always On可用性组是MSSQL中实现高可用性的核心技术之一。它允许将一个或多个用户数据库配置为副本,在主服…

    2025年1月19日
    700

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部